Thesis Template: ÉTS (École de technologie supérieure)

ÉTS (École de technologie supérieure) is an engineering school affiliated with UQAM that trains engineers at the graduate level. Its guides and templates page offers Word and LaTeX resources for the presentation of theses and dissertations. Here is the essential information for preparing your document in a compliant way.


Formatting requirements

ParameterRequirement
Paper sizeLetter
Templates providedWord and LaTeX
Submission formatPDF or PDF/A (a single file, except for LaTeX)
Bibliographic styleIEEE recommended (engineering)

The margins, fonts and line spacing are defined in the official templates. It is strongly recommended to use the template rather than configuring everything manually.

Document structure

Front matter:

  1. Title page (including the ÉTS logo)
  2. Committee presentation
  3. Foreword (optional)
  4. Summary (French)
  5. Abstract (English)
  6. Table of contents
  7. List of tables
  8. List of figures
  9. List of abbreviations

Body: 10. Introduction 11. Chapters 12. Conclusion 13. Recommendations (if applicable) 14. References (IEEE style) 15. Appendices

Common mistakes to avoid

  1. Submitting several PDF files: a single file is required (except for the LaTeX exception).
  2. Bibliographic style other than IEEE: ÉTS is an engineering school, IEEE is the norm.
  3. Missing or incorrect ÉTS logo: the title page must use the official logo.
  4. Missing summaries: both French AND English are required.
